ipados 13 keyboard not working

Sometimes the keyboard on my iPad suddenly stops working. It works for a while and then when I go back to google chrome to search for something (It may be chrome that is the problem) then the keyboard doesn't work. It is very annoying having to restart my iPad all the time. I only had this problem after updating to iPadOS 13.

Hello,


Try resetting iPad's settings in Settings > General > Reset > Reset All Settings. Be certain you do not select Erase All Content and Settings as this will erase all of your information. It is a good idea to perform a backup of your iPad prior to resetting its settings.
